Bandi Chhor Gurdwara




Bandi Chhor Gurdwara, a white tall structure, is situated inside the Gwalior Fort. It was here that Emperor Jahangir had imprisoned the sixth Sikh preacher, Guru Hargobind. The Gurdwara has two ponds. The complex has a square hall, big dining hall and residential rooms. Visitors must cover their heads with a cloth before entering the Gurdwara. Gwalior, a major city of Madhya Pradesh, is 120 km south of Agra and is well connected by rail and road.
